E-MAX is a step forward in the evolution of ultra-high molecular weight polyethylene for total joint bearing surfaces.
Highly crosslinked A proven strategy for reducing in vivo wear.
Mechanically annealed Eliminates* free radicals without the problems (such as reduced strength) associated with melt-annealing.
Vitamin E blended Provides excellent resistance to oxidation.
E-MAX Design Rationale
Design Requirements
E-MAX was developed to build on the successes of first-generation XLPE, while addressing the trade-offs currently associated with these materials. In general, the goal is a material that fulfills three primary design requirements: wear resistance, oxidative stability, and maintenance of mechanical properties. (Figure 3)
PE Design Requirements. (a) Poor wear resistance and oxidative stability for conventional PE. (b) Improved wear and oxidation but reduced mechanical properties for melt-annealed XLPE. (c) Balanced for E-MAX.
